Matching Funds in Arizona

Posted on October 15, 2008 by Eric Brown

For now, it looks like Arizona’s matching funds program has been upheld in a lawsuit challenging its constitutionality. A judge on Tuesday refused to cut off supplemental money provided to publicly funded Arizona election candidates who are outspent by private … Continue reading →
